Introduction to Clean HDMI Output
Clean HDMI output refers to a feature found in various devices, including cameras, camcorders, and gaming consoles, which allows them to output a raw, uncompressed video signal through an HDMI connection. This signal is free from any overlays, menus, or other graphical elements that are typically displayed on the device’s screen. The result is a pure, unadulterated video feed that can be used for a variety of purposes, such as recording, streaming, or displaying on an external monitor.

What is Clean HDMI Output and How Does it Work?
Clean HDMI output refers to the ability of a device, such as a camera or a gaming console, to output a video signal through an HDMI connection without any overlays or information displays. This means that the output is “clean” and free from any on-screen displays, menus, or other graphics that may be present when the device is connected to a monitor or TV. The clean HDMI output is typically used for professional applications, such as video production, live streaming, and broadcasting, where a high-quality, distraction-free video signal is required.
The clean HDMI output works by bypassing the device’s on-screen display and sending a raw video signal directly to the connected device. This can be achieved through various methods, including menu settings, firmware updates, or the use of specialized hardware. For example, some cameras have a “clean output” or ” HDMI output” setting that can be enabled in the menu, while others may require a firmware update to unlock this feature. Additionally, some devices may have a dedicated clean HDMI output port or a specific cable that is designed to provide a clean signal. By using a clean HDMI output, users can ensure that their video signal is of the highest quality and free from any distractions or overlays.

Can I Use Clean HDMI Output for Live Streaming and Broadcasting?
Yes, clean HDMI output can be used for live streaming and broadcasting applications. In fact, clean HDMI output is often a requirement for professional live streaming and broadcasting, as it provides a high-quality, distraction-free video signal that can be easily transmitted to a wide audience. By using a clean HDMI output, live streamers and broadcasters can ensure that their video signal is of the highest quality and free from any on-screen displays or overlays that may be distracting or affect the overall aesthetic of the video.
To use clean HDMI output for live streaming and broadcasting, users typically need to connect their device to a capture card or a streaming device, such as a computer or a dedicated streaming box, using an HDMI cable. The capture card or streaming device can then receive the clean HDMI output signal and transmit it to a live streaming platform, such as YouTube or Facebook, or to a broadcasting network. Additionally, users may need to configure their device’s output settings, such as the resolution, frame rate, and bitrate, to match the requirements of the live streaming or broadcasting platform.
What are the Limitations and Potential Drawbacks of Using Clean HDMI Output?
While clean HDMI output offers several benefits, there are also some limitations and potential drawbacks to consider. One of the main limitations is that clean HDMI output may not be available on all devices or in all situations. For example, some devices may not have a clean output mode, or the mode may be limited to specific resolutions or frame rates. Additionally, clean HDMI output may require a firmware update or the installation of specialized software, which can be time-consuming and may require technical expertise.
Another potential drawback of using clean HDMI output is that it may not provide any on-screen displays or overlays, which can make it difficult to monitor the device’s settings or status. For example, users may not be able to see the device’s battery level, storage capacity, or other important information when using clean HDMI output. To overcome this limitation, users may need to use external monitoring equipment, such as a separate monitor or a field monitor, to keep track of the device’s settings and status. By understanding the limitations and potential drawbacks of clean HDMI output, users can make informed decisions about when and how to use this feature.
